◎Usage of Overview
An “overview” of a situation is a general understanding or description of it as a whole. This word should only be used as a noun, and not a verb. That is,
Incorrect: This paper overviews the properties of long wavelength optical amplifiers.
Correct: This paper presents an overview of the properties of long wavelength optical amplifiers.
In the incorrect example, “overview” can also be replaced by a suitable verb, such as “review” or “examine.” That is,
Also correct: This paper reviews the properties of long wavelength optical amplifiers.
